Allium Cultivation in the Nation : Possibilities and Hurdles

Garlic production in Kenya is quickly becoming a profitable enterprise , presenting substantial chances for producers, especially in upland regions. Consumption for garlic, both domestically and for export to regional areas, is increasing , fueled by its preference in Kenyan cuisine and its use in the medicinal field. However, this growing industry faces several challenges . These include limited access to quality planting material, increasing production expenses , after-harvest waste due to inadequate preservation facilities, and fluctuations in trading costs.

  • Insufficient access to funds
  • Disease and unwanted plant infestation
  • Shortage of specialized knowledge among growers

Addressing these problems through improved farming practices , government support , and funding in facilities is vital to capitalizing on the full feasibility of garlic production in Kenya.
